Drew Allar Impresses in NFL Debut, Final Box Score Stats & Highlights from Steelers vs. Packers
Key Points:
- Drew Allar, a former Penn State quarterback, made an impressive NFL preseason debut for the Pittsburgh Steelers against the Green Bay Packers, contributing to a 28-9 victory.
- Allar completed 10 of 13 passes for 153 yards and threw two touchdown passes, in addition to scoring a rushing touchdown.
- He entered the game in the third quarter after Mason Rudolph and Will Howard had played earlier drives, showcasing a strong performance despite not having played since a season-ending ankle injury last October.
- Allar’s debut included a 75-yard completion on his first pass and multiple touchdown connections, signaling a promising return to form.
- With Aaron Rodgers expected to retire after this season, Allar is positioned to compete for the starting quarterback role in the next offseason.
